php把图片转换成二进制字符串的方法:首先通过“$_files['file']['tmp_name'];”方法获取临时文件名;然后通过base64encodeimage函数将图片文件转成二进制流;最后输出转换结果即可。
推荐:《php视频教程》
php将图片转成二进制流
//获取临时文件名
$strtmpname = $_files['file']['tmp_name'];//转成二进制流
$strdata = base64encodeimage(strtmpname );//输出
<img src='$strdata'>function base64encodeimage($strtmpname){ $base64image = ''; $imageinfo = getimagesize($strtmpname); $imagedata = fread(fopen($strtmpname , 'r'), filesize($strtmpname)); $base64image = 'data:' . $imageinfo['mime'] . ';base64,' . chunk_split(base64_encode($imagedata)); return $base64image;}
目前编写计算机程序一般采用的是什么19阿里云爆款服务器领券租云服务器注意什么南京云主机服务器租用费用多少新站seo优化要避免的事情部署后打不开请核实下直接在后面粘贴吗还是把前面的删掉啊Linux.org公告:在linux.dev域名下提供邮件托管服务电脑中如何在cmd中正确使用cd命令切换文件目录